446 Northwest Mall
Houston, Texas 77092

Its the Holiday season and the North Pole is buzzing with excitement. Santa is about to pick a new leader for the sleigh team. There are so many talented...
See the full event listing at American Towns

Added by Upcoming Robot on Invalid date